OPENQUERY
Microsoft SQL Server에서 사용되는 T-SQL 함수 중 하나로,
원격 서버에 대한 쿼리를 실행하고 결과를 가져오는 데 사용됩니다.
이 함수는 분산 데이터베이스 환경에서 다른 데이터베이스 서버 또는 소스에 대한 쿼리를 실행하고
데이터를 가져올 때 유용합니다.
OPENQUERY 함수는 다음과 같은 형식을 가집니다:
OPENQUERY ( linked_server , 'query' )
- linked_server: 연결된 서버(Linked Server)의 이름 또는 별명을 나타냅니다.
연결된 서버는 현재 SQL Server와 다른 데이터베이스 서버 또는 데이터 소스와의 연결을 설정하는 데 사용됩니다. - 'query': 실행할 원격 쿼리를 나타냅니다. 이 부분에는 연결된 서버에서 실행할 SQL 쿼리가 들어갑니다.
이러한 방식으로 OPENQUERY를 사용하면
다른 데이터베이스 서버 또는 소스와의 데이터 통합 및 조회 작업을 수행할 수 있습니다.
'DB > etc' 카테고리의 다른 글
데이터베이스 트리거(Database Trigger) (0) | 2023.10.10 |
---|---|
MSSQL 자동 증가 열(IDENTITY)과 시퀀스(Sequence) (0) | 2023.10.05 |
MSSQL OPTION(RECOMPILE) (1) | 2023.10.05 |
매핑 테이블(mapping table) (1) | 2023.10.05 |
DB 트랜잭션 (0) | 2023.10.05 |
댓글